Tonya Dooley of Memorial Hospital has been awarded Hancock County’s Best Physical Therapist, earning the 2025 Dammy Award. This honor spotlights her commitment to patient care, as well as the hospital’s dedication to providing comprehensive therapy services. Patients at Memorial Hospital benefit from advanced transitional care and a skilled, collaborative team that guides each step of the recovery process. Colleagues and patients alike credit Dooley’s compassion and expertise as key factors in their treatment successes. The Dammy Award reflects not only her individual achievements but also the hospital’s broader mission to enhance rehabilitation outcomes across the county.

“I’m honored to receive this award,” said Dooley. “Helping patients regain strength, mobility, and confidence is incredibly meaningful. I’m grateful to be part of a team that truly puts patient care at the heart of everything we do.”

Memorial Hospital is reinforcing its commitment to patient recovery by providing physical and occupational therapy services to acute inpatients five days a week. The therapy team, led by Tonya Dooley, works closely with medical staff to ensure each patient receives personalized rehabilitative support. For those transitioning out of acute care, the hospital offers a Transitional Care (Swing Bed) Program, featuring daily therapy, skilled nursing, and access to essential services like lab work, X-rays, and emergency care.
